OBS

[Inarticulate brachiopods of the] Family Trematidae (...) [have a] marginal beak of [the] brachial valve (...) [which] protrudes beyond [the] pedicle valve; [the] pedicle opening extends to [the] posterior margin of [the] pedicle valve in all growth stages. M. Ord. - Dev.
